当前位置:   article > 正文

Git pull避免Merge branch_如何去除merge branch

如何去除merge branch

1.问题

在使用Git代码仓库管理项目代码时,使用git pull拉取远程代码后,git log查看,会发现本地分支指向:Merge branch “分支名称” of ssh “远端分支”,缺少 Change-Id: …
由于缺少 change-id 此时如果修改本地代码,再提交到远端分支,就会报错;

2.避免Merge branch

# 方法1
git config --global pull.rebase true

# 方法2,在使用git pull拉取远端代码时,加上 --rebase 即可;
# 如果没有冲突,则会直接合并,如果存在冲突,手动解决冲突即可,不会再产生那条多余的信息
git pull --rebase

  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7
声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/笔触狂放9/article/detail/688682
推荐阅读
相关标签
  

闽ICP备14008679号